Prime Health and Health Insurance: How are they Different

Prime Health and health insurance work very differently. With Prime Health, you don’t pay monthly premiums; instead, you pay for actual treatment costs through zero-interest EMIs. It mainly covers elective or planned treatments, such as cosmetic, maternity, or orthopaedic procedures, and provides immediate access without waiting periods. Health insurance, on the other hand, requires regular premiums, may include co-pays or exclusions, and usually only covers medically necessary procedures, sometimes with waiting periods.

The way payments and eligibility are handled also sets them apart. Prime Health settles bills directly with hospitals and lets you repay flexibly over up to 24 months, with approval based on simple credit checks. Insurance requires claim approval or reimbursement, has fixed annual renewals, and eligibility depends on age, health history, and pre-existing conditions. While Prime Health fills gaps by covering elective treatments, insurance protects against unexpected medical expenses.

Applying for healthcare financing through the Prime Health programme is structured to be seamless, with minimal paperwork and fast approvals. Here are the steps you need to follow:

  • Patient Counselling: When you visit your hospital or healthcare provider for treatment planning, a hospital counsellor or a Poonawalla Fincorp representative will inform you about the EMI financing options available under the Prime Health programme.
  • Eligibility Check: Poonawalla Fincorp system performs an instant credit check using your PAN, Aadhaar, bank details, and bureau score. 
  • Digital Application: After your eligibility is confirmed, you will receive a digital loan application. You can e-sign the loan agreement using a simple OTP verification.
  • Loan Approval: Once your application is processed, you’ll receive an approval confirmation instantly.
  • Direct Settlement: Once approved, Poonawalla Fincorp settles the treatment amount directly with the hospital, usually within 1-2 working days.
